About the Church

Ann Street UMC is a beautiful historic church located in the quaint coastal town of Beaufort, North Carolina. Ann Street was established in 1778, and the current building was constructed in 1854. Ann Street UMC’s congregation is vibrant, active, and inclusive, with an average worship attendance of 140 and growing. The worship style is joyful, meaningful, and informal‑traditional.

At present, Ann Street UMC is refurbishing and revoicing its 1963 Schantz organ. With the addition of new ranks, we will have grown from 600 to over 1000 pipes. We are seeking a talented musician with strengths in organ and piano who will be able to utilize the organ to its fullest while supporting and sharing in the highly valued and vital music ministry of the church.

Job Summary

The primary focus of this job is to serve as church organist for weekly and special services and as choir accompanist for weekly choir rehearsals and services.

Minimum Qualifications
  • A 4‑year degree or higher in music is preferred.
  • Excellent piano playing skills as demonstrated in a hiring audition.
  • Organ performance skills are preferred.
  • Experience in church music settings is preferred.
  • Foundational understanding of and adherence to the Christian faith.
Physical Requirements

Able to freely move about the church facility and grounds.

Core Competencies

This position requires approximately 10‑20 hours a week. Time involvement varies greatly throughout the year and is largely dependent on how quickly the individual is able to master the music. Independent practice is a vital aspect of this position.

  • Ability to not only play accompaniment for choir, but also vocal lines.
  • Sight‑reading and score reduction skills preferred.
  • Interpersonal relationships: relates well to all kinds of people, builds rapport, uses diplomacy and tact, is regarded as a team player.
  • Trust and integrity: is able to communicate honestly and directly, and is joyfully flexible.
Essential Functions

Weekly

  • For the 10:00 am Sunday Worship Service: select and play prelude and postlude, and play selected music for hymns, choir anthems, etc. as communicated by the Director of Music Ministries and the Pastor.
  • Communicate selection titles to the church office via email by 8:00 am Thursday mornings.
  • Prepare and play assigned church hymns on organ during the 10:00 am service. The pastor and/or Director of Music Ministries will select and communicate hymns in advance.
  • Accompany the choir on piano during Thursday night rehearsals. Rehearsals are held from 6:30 pm to 7:30 pm and extend to 8 pm during cantata seasons. Choral anthems will be selected by the Director of Music Ministries and communicated in advance.
  • Assist in warming the choir up before the 10:00 am service by reporting to the choir room prior to the service at a time determined by the Director of Music Ministries on Sunday mornings with all needed materials for the day.
  • Meet with the Director of Music Ministries and the Pastor for Worship planning at a mutually agreed upon time, initially once a week, then as needed.
  • Preparation and practice are ongoing. Organist/Pianist will have familiarized themselves with all musical material (hymns, service music, anthems accompaniments and open score) and practiced in advance to a high level of accuracy prior to each rehearsal/performance.
  • Attendance at weekly Monday morning Staff Meetings is preferred.

Monthly

  • Additional music prepared and played during communion the first Sunday of every month.

Occasionally

  • Accompany and rehearse with soloists or small groups. Some vocalists will need additional help reading/learning the music.
  • Prepare and play additional services throughout the year.
  • Christmas Eve – Ann Street UMC has one Christmas Eve service at 5:00 pm.
  • Easter Season – extra musical performances during Ash Wednesday, Holy Week, and Easter.
  • July 4th Ringing of the Bell Service.
  • Funerals are the responsibility of the organist.
  • At the organist’s discretion, play for weddings. Weddings earn a stipend of $500.00.
Working as a Team

Collaboration:

Planning and implementing worship is a collaborative effort with the goal of aligning the music with the message and theme of the service. Open communication between the Director of Music Ministries, the Church Organist/Accompanist, and the Pastor is necessary and expected.
